StudioCMS Project Creation CLI
npm install create-studiocms

CLI Utility Toolkit used for setting up a new project using StudioCMS Ecosystem packages, as well as other utilities.

create-studiocms automatically runs in _interactive_ mode, but you can also specify your project name and template with command line arguments.
`shnpm
npm create studiocms@latest --template studiocms/basics --project-name my-studiocms-project

When using
--template the default behavior is to search the Templates repo and is declared as folders. for example the studiocms/basics templates points to the basics project within the studiocms folder at the root of the repo.Full CLI Options and commands

Usage: create-studiocms [options]This command will open an interactive CLI prompt to guide you through
the process of creating a new StudioCMS(or StudioCMS Ecosystem package)
project using one of the available templates.
Options:
-t, --template The template to use.
-r, --template-ref The template reference to use.
-p, --project-name The name of the project.
-i, --install Install dependencies.
-g, --git Initialize a git repository.
-y, --yes Skip all prompts and use default values.
-n, --no Skip all prompts and use default values.
-q, --skip-banners Skip all banners and messages.
-d, --dry-run Do not perform any actions.
-h, --help display help for command
-v, --version Output the current version of the CLI Toolkit.
--do-not-install Do not install dependencies.
--do-not-init-git Do not initializing a git repository.
--color force color output
--no-color disable color output
